Book Description

May 6 2002 Bible (Book 113)
After Effects has been established as the world's most powerful and cost-effective solution for motion graphics professionals. The application has revolutionized the broadcast industry. Proof of the revolution was clear when the mid-1990s revealed a dazzling array of visual artistry in ad campaigns and television network promotions, the quality and the quantity of which had never been seen.

Version 5.0 was a major upgrade (3D, expressions, parenting, to name a few) and Version 5.5 could hardly be considered a dot release. Truly phenomenal software, this build of After Effects boasts a variety of new features as well as vast enhancements to its user interface. There are numerous new filters for concretizing any visual effects that the mind can envision. Additionally, After Effects 5.5 includes improved 3D-compositing capabilities, greater command over expressions with the Expression Controls effects, as well as native support for OSX, among numerous other improvements.

The After Effects Bible looks into every aspect of the application. Whether you're completely new to motion graphics, or an experienced hand looking for ways to get the most out of the recent upgrade, there is valuable, time-saving information to be found in each chapter. There are step exercises for everything from creating complex keyframe animations to animating cameras in 3D space. Whether it's read from front-to-back or used as a desktop reference, the After Effects Bible belongs in the motion graphic designer's library.

About the Author

J.J. Marshall is a born and bred resident of New York City who makes his living there as a broadcast designer and a digital video consultant. Most recently, he assisted in developing a nationwide broadband news-on-demand network called The FeedRoom. Prior to that, he helped introduce Oxygen Media to the joys of Final Cut Pro and After Effects while editing a weekly 2-hour show. Some more of his past efforts have included freelance projects for the New York New Media Association(NYNMA), Liz Claiborne, NetShoot, and the Center for Neurobiology and Behavior at Columbia University, as well as independent documentary productions that have aired on PBS. Teaching credits include courses in digital video at open-I Media and the School of Visual Arts (SVA). While writing this book, he served as a beta tester on the latest version of After Effects. A self-proclaimed refugee from the world of theatre, J.J. has long been creating data-driven art in one form or another.

Zed Saeed lives and works in New York City as a freelance digital-media consultant specializing in editing, compositing, and workflow issues. Zed served as a senior post-production consultant for Apple Computer and Oxygen Media on Final Cut Pro and digital-video workflow design and has worked with Media 100 and Adobe Systems on video-related products. He has also worked as an editor, producer, compositing artist, and broadcast designer at Showtime Channels, Sundance Channel, and ESPN Classics. Zed has written articles on digital media technologies for magazines and has served on the faculty of NYU Graduate School, Parsons School of Design, and New School University. Zed has written, produced, and edited videos that have received awards and recognition by the Academy of Television Arts and Sciences and the American Film Institute. Zed is also the author of Final Cut Pro 2 Bible.

5.0 out of 5 stars Great Recource, no fat Mar 15 2003
Format:Paperback
I am a moderate after effects user.. There are quite a few things that are not so easy to grasp.. This book explains everything, in depth, in terms anyone can understand.. You do not need to be sitting at the computer to follow their tutorials, to learn how to do a new skill (very nice, I am not a huge fan of reading, and being on the computer..).
I'd say this is the best recource available for after effects to date.
If you found The creating motion graphics series to be annoying / time consuming, get this book, it renders it all down to an easier and faster learning experience.
